package org.apache.wink.common.internal;
import java.util.List;
import javax.ws.rs.core.MultivaluedMap;
import junit.framework.TestCase;
public class MultivaluedMapImplTest extends TestCase {
public void testMultivaluedMapImplOperations() {
MultivaluedMap<String, String> map = getMultivaluedMap();
assertMap(map);
}
public void testMultivaluedMapImplClone() {
M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String> map = getMultivaluedMap();
MultivaluedMap<String, String> clone = map.clone();
assertMap(clone);
}
public void testToString() {
String string = MultivaluedMapImpl.toString(getMultivaluedMap(), ",");
String expected = "a=a1,b=b1,c=c1,c=c2,d";
assertEquals(expected, string);
}
private M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String> getMultivaluedMap() {
M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String> map = new M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String>();
map.add("a", "a1");
map.add("b", "b1");
map.add("c", "c1");
map.add("c", "c2");
map.add("d", null);
return map;
}
private void assertMap(MultivaluedMap<String, String> map) {
List<String> list = map.get("a");
assertNotNull(list);
assertTrue(list.size() == 1);
assertEquals(list.get(0), "a1");
list = map.get("b");
assertNotNull(list);
assertTrue(list.size() == 1);
assertEquals(list.get(0), "b1");
assertEquals(map.getFirst("b"), "b1");
list = map.get("c");
assertNotNull(list);
assertTrue(list.size() == 2);
assertEquals(list.get(0), "c1");
assertEquals(list.get(1), "c2");
assertEquals(map.getFirst("c"), "c1");
list = map.get("d");
assertNotNull(list);
assertTrue(list.size() == 1);
assertNull(list.get(0));
map.putSingle("c", "c3");
list = map.get("c");
assertNotNull(list);
assertTrue(list.size() == 1);
assertEquals(list.get(0), "c3");
assertEquals(map.getFirst("c"), "c3");
assertNull(map.get("e"));
}
public void testNullValue() {
M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String> map = new MultivaluedMapImpl<String, String>();
map.putSingle(null, "valueForNull");
map.putSingle("d", null);
assertEquals("valueForNull", map.getFirst(null));
assertEquals(null, map.getFirst("d"));
assertEquals("[null=valueForNull,d]", map.toString());
}
}
